STATE FIRE CODE == ADVISORY COMMITTEE 1 2 ESTABLISHED. 1 3 1. The division of fire protection in the department of 1 4 public safety shall establish a state fire code advisory 1 5 committee. The state fire marshal shall serve as chairperson 1 6 of the committee. Members shall include a representative of 1 7 each of the following, appointed by the respective entity or 1 8 that entity's successor, or, in the case of members appointed 1 9 pursuant to paragraphs "b" through "e", appointed by the state 1 10 fire marshal: 1 11 a. The state fire service and emergency response council. 1 12 b. State and local building inspectors. 1 13 c. A licensed engineer. 1 14 d. A licensed architect. 1 15 e. The homebuilding industry. 1 16 f. The Iowa association of professional fire chiefs. 1 17 g. The department of inspections and appeals. 1 18 h. The state fire marshal association. 1 19 i. The Iowa firemen's association. 1 20 The chairperson may designate additional entities for 1 21 inclusion on the committee. 1 22 2. Members shall serve staggered terms of two years. 1 23 Appointments of members of the committee shall comply with 1 24 sections 69.16 and 69.16A. Vacancies shall be filled by the 1 25 original appointing authority and in the manner of the 1 26 original appointment. 1 27 3. Members shall receive actual expenses incurred while 1 28 serving in their official capacity and may also be eligible to 1 29 receive compensation as provided in section 7E.6. A majority 1 30 of the members of the committee shall constitute a quorum. 1 31 4. The advisory committee shall review existing fire 1 32 safety codes, identify instances where codes have become out= 1 33 of=date or where conflicts exist between various codes, 1 34 consider the advantages to be gained from an integrated fire 1 35 code, and make recommendations for the implementation of an 2 1 integrated state fire code. The committee shall submit a 2 2 report of its recommendations to the members of the general 2 3 assembly by January 1, 2007. 2 4 5.
